Quick Answer
The Middle East activewear market has evolved significantly, moving from basic sportswear to a sophisticated blend of performance and style. Historically, demand was limited, but rising incomes and a focus on wellness are fueling growth. Currently, we observe a strong preference for modest designs that align with cultural values, alongside a surge in athleisure trends. This presents opportunities for brands offering both performance-driven and fashion-forward activewear. Fashion Intel predicts continued growth, with online channels playing a crucial role in reaching consumers across the region. Expect to see increased demand for sustainable options and personalized shopping experiences.

Key Trends
- Modest activewear is projected to grow by 15% in the next year, driven by cultural preferences.
- Athleisure styles are seeing a 20% increase in popularity, blurring the lines between workout and everyday wear.
- Saudi Arabia and the UAE are leading the demand for high-end activewear brands.
- Sustainable activewear fabrics are gaining traction, with a 10% increase in consumer interest.
- Online sales channels are becoming increasingly important, accounting for 35% of activewear purchases.
